Output 58941dba5afbb012e09e5d094382362ade75a39d9ffd8a83548637dcab8e8ec1:39

value
1306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3e98783b1764a4d0e55d8ffd1d74fc413dff033a7dcc648d976491d2d35d45c
address
bc1pu05c0qa3we9y6rj4mrlar460csfalupn5lwvvjxewey36tf463wqwdlcaa
transaction
58941dba5afbb012e09e5d094382362ade75a39d9ffd8a83548637dcab8e8ec1
spent
true